Course Content

• Introduction to Cosmology and the Big Bang Theory
• The Early Universe and its Thermal History
• Physics of the Cosmic Microwave Background Radiation (CMB)
• CMB Anisotropies and their Significance
• CMB Polarization and Primordial Gravitational Waves
• Data Analysis Techniques for CMB Observations
• Advanced Cosmological Models and CMB Constraints
• The Physics of Inflation and its Imprint on the CMB
• CMB and the Search for New Physics
